IRISH HOME RULE ENVOYS.

COLLECTIONS TO DATE. (United Press Association.) WELLINGTON, Monday. Altogether the Irish envoys have now collected ahout £6OOO in New Zealand for the Home Rule cause. Messrs Donovan and Redmond have just completed their visit to the Nelson, Westland >and Blenheim districts, where £1313 was collected!, against £594 collected in f the same districts five years ago. The (iimoimt contributed iii each town visited were follows :—Grevmouth. £460 ; Westport, £250; Ho.kiti.ka, £125; Kuimatra,, £120; Reef ton. £110; Blenheim, £100; Nelson. £80; Ross, £7O; Otira, £SO. N Messrs Dwnovan, and Redmond' will be at Me'thven, on the 29th ins*., .and on the fdl'lowires: dav they will join Mr. Haaelton at bama.ru. and subsequently pay their first visit to Otago.
